Possible causes include:

1. Hyperlipidemia: Excessive filtration of lipids from the glomerulus, resulting in lipuria;

2. Kidney disease: In cases of nephrotic syndrome, hyperlipidemia and lipuria may occur. Nephritis can sometimes cause oil spots in the urine.

3. Chyluria: White milky urine, the main components of which are triglycerides, albumin, cholesterol, etc. Lipiduria may also occur.
